it-swarm.com.de

Wie erhalte ich in C # einen Pfad zum Desktop für den aktuellen Benutzer?

Wie erhalte ich in C # einen Pfad zum Desktop für den aktuellen Benutzer?

Das einzige, was ich finden konnte, war die VB.NET-only-Klasse SpecialDirectories , die diese Eigenschaft hat:

My.Computer.FileSystem.SpecialDirectories.Desktop

Wie kann ich das in C # machen?

320
string path = Environment.GetFolderPath(Environment.SpecialFolder.Desktop);
721
Marc Gravell
 string filePath = Environment.GetFolderPath(Environment.SpecialFolder.Desktop);
 string extension = ".log";
 filePath += @"\Error Log\" + extension;
 if (!Directory.Exists(filePath))
 {
      Directory.CreateDirectory(filePath);
 }
21
bipin